Here’s a New Music Video to Prove BULLET FOR MY VALENTINE Are “Not Dead Yet”
Bullet For My Valentine have released a new video for “Not Dead Yet” ahead of their October & November European headline tour.

Bullet For My Valentine have revealed an official video for “Not Dead Yet” a track taken from their current studio album, Gravity, out now via Search & Destroy/ Spinefarm Records.
BFMV frontman, Matt Tuck, says; “We shot our latest video for “Not Dead Yet” in Japan after our Summersonic 2018 performances. We’ve never done a video there before so thought, ‘why not?!’ Visually it’s stunning thanks to the amazing work by Japanese filmmakers Maxilla. We love this track and can’t wait for you all to see the new video.”
